What should energy producers and traders expect in 2021 and beyond?

The effects of COVID-19 will likely spill over into 2021 – especially in energy production and trading. The short-term outlook for the energy industry is a bit bearish due to low economic activity which leads to higher volatilities in energy demand and supply patterns. Energy companies should consider the following industry scenarios likely to be prevalent through 2021:
  • Demand for oil is expected to rise slowly, even as travel and tourism gradually pick up steam (once the vaccine is out)
  • Overall pricing (including coal and natural gas) will stabilize in 2021
  • The renewable energy sector will show promise, with capacity additions anticipated to show an increase of about 10% in 2021; renewables will account for close to 95% of the net rise in global power capacity by 20251
  • Digital transformation of the power industry could face some setbacks from electricity grids, with security and reliability proving to be major concerns
2020 has surely altered the dynamics of the energy industry and it is without a doubt that digitalization will play a key role in reshaping its future. Interconnected, intelligent, resilient, sustainable, efficient, and reliable systems will calculate energy needs and ensure delivery to the right place at the right time and at optimal cost. The transformational power of digitalization breaks all boundaries between different energy sectors, increases flexibility, and facilitates integration across large-scale grid networks. A 2019 Deloitte survey reports that 95% of energy executives believe digital transformation is a top strategic priority2, so it isn’t surprising that digitalization in the energy industry is anticipated to be a $64 Billion market by 20253. Energy organizations will be powering up investments in advanced and intelligent technologies such as IoT, cloud computing, and Robotic Process Automation (RPA).
